Permit Information. Several lifetime permit options are available through our program; the Nebraska Game and Parks Foundation will pay half the cost for these permits. Winners must be Nebraska residents age 15 or younger at the time of the drawing. Only one permit may be awarded to a winner in a drawing..

The Nebraska Game and Parks Commission will consider staff recommendations to increase the fee for state park entry permits when it meets Aug. 4 in Valentine. The meeting will begin at 8 a.m. Central time at the Niobrara Lodge, 803 E. Highway 20. There are many ways to spend a day at the fort.Nebraska special auction permits are open to residents of any state. Each year, some of our partner conservation organizations auction off a limited number of special permits.
